Ingredients

This Frankenstein cake is made with moist green velvet layers and rich cream cheese buttercream. Here’s what you need:

For the Cake

  • 2 1/2 cups cake flour (300g)
  • 2 Tbsp unsweetened cocoa powder, sifted (10g)
  • 1 tsp baking soda (6g)
  • 1/2 tsp fine salt (3g)
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, room temperature (113g)
  • 1 3/4 cups granulated sugar (350g)
  • 2 large eggs, room temperature (112g)
  • 1 1/4 cups buttermilk, room temperature (300g)
  • 2/3 cup vegetable or canola oil (145g)
  • 2 squirts of green gel food coloring (or 1 Tbsp liquid food coloring)
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ract or vanilla bean paste (8g)
  • 1 tsp white vinegar (4g)

For the Frosting

  • 1 1/2 cups unsalted butter, room temperature (339g – 3 sticks)
  • 1/2 cup full-fat cream cheese, room temperature (113g or 4 oz.)
  • 1 Tbsp vanilla extract or vanilla bean paste (12g)
  • 1 tsp fine salt (6g)
  • 8 cups powdered sugar (1000g)
  • 2 Tbsp heavy whipping cream, room temperature (30g)

Decoration

  • Electric Green Gel Food Coloring
  • Black Gel Food Coloring

How to Make Frankenstein Cake

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ease two 9-inch round cake pans with cooking spray or butter and line them with parchment paper.

Step 2: Prepare Dry Ingredients

In a medium bowl, sift together:
1. Cake flour
2. Cocoa powder
3. Baking soda
4. Salt

Set this mixture aside.

Step 3: Mix Wet Ingredients

In a large bowl:
1. Cream together the unsalted but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y.
2. Add e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ition.
3. Incorporate buttermilk, vegetable oil, green gel food coloring, vanilla extract, and white vinegar until combined.

Step 4: Combine Mixtures

Gradually add the dry ingredients into the wet mixture:
– Mix until just combined; do not overmix.

Step 5: Bake the Cakes

Pour equal amounts of batter into prepared pans.
– Bake in preheated oven for about 28 minutes or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ean.
– Allow cakes to cool in pans for 10 minutes before transferring to wire racks.

Step 6: Make the Cream Cheese Frosting

In a large bowl:
1. Beat unsalted butter and cream cheese together until creamy.
2. Gradually add powdered sugar; mix until smooth.
3. Add vanilla extract, salt, and heavy whipping cream; beat until fluffy.

Step 7: Assemble the Cake

Once cakes are cool:
– Place one layer on your spinning cake stand.
– Spread a layer of frosting on top before adding the second layer.
– Frost the top and sides of the entire cake smoothly using your offset spatula.

Step 8: Decorate Your Cake

Use green gel food coloring to create fun designs on the frosting:
– Use black gel food coloring for facial features like eyes and mouth using piping tips as desired.

How to Perfect Frankenstein Cake

To ensure your Frankenstein cake turns out flawlessly, consider these helpful tips that will make baking easier and more enjoyable.

  • Use Room Temperature Ingredients: Make sure your butter, eggs, and buttermilk are at room temperature. This helps create a smoother batter and ensures even baking.

  • Measure Accurately: Use a kitchen scale for precise measurements, especially when working with flour and sugar. This will help maintain the right texture in your cake.

  • Don’t Overmix: Once you combine wet and dry ingredients, mix just until combined. Overmixing can lead to a dense cake rather than a light and fluffy one.

  • Check Oven Temperature: Always preheat your oven and use an oven thermometer to ensure it’s at the right temperature before baking. This prevents uneven baking.

  • Cool Completely: Allow the cakes to cool completely before frosting. This prevents melting the buttercream and ensures clean layers when stacking.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When making a Frankenstein Cake, it’s easy to overlook some key steps that can affect the outcome. Here are common mistakes and how to avoid them.

  • Skipping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ensure all ingredients like butter, eggs, and buttermilk are at room temperature. This helps create a smooth batter and improves texture.
  • Not Measuring Flour Correctly: Use the spoon-and-level method instead of scooping directly from the bag. This prevents using too much flour, which can make the cake dense.
  • Ignoring Baking Time: Each oven is different. Start checking for doneness 5 minutes before the suggested time by inserting a toothpick into the center. It should come out clean or with a few crumbs.
  • Underestimating Cooling Time: Allow the cake layers to cool completely before frosting. A warm cake can cause the frosting to melt and slide off.
  • Overmixing Batter: Mix just until combined after adding dry ingredients. Overmixing can lead to a tough texture in your Frankenstein Cake.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Store leftover Frankenstein Cake in an airtight container.
  • It can last up to 5 days in the fridge.

Freezing Frankenstein Cake

  • Wrap individual slices or whole layers tightly in plastic wrap and then foil for best protection.
  • The cake can be frozen for up to 3 months.
